Transaction 0657828c167a83ebcb22f047101d692345f18c48e46f61256d89e41e11425322

2 Input
2 Outputs
  • 0657828c167a83ebcb22f047101d692345f18c48e46f61256d89e41e11425322:0
  • value  3171440
    address  1Pzwe5GHy6jSrCwWdpZorqQ9hh982r5ELc
  • 0657828c167a83ebcb22f047101d692345f18c48e46f61256d89e41e11425322:1
  • value  1045
    address  34fDFoj4gSL4ZPrGQm4PGCzbUFGJQwaboY